OpendTect  6.6
uivolumereader.h
Go to the documentation of this file.
1 #pragma once
2 
3 /*+
4 
5 _________________________________________________________________________
6 
7  (C) dGB Beheer B.V.; (LICENSE) http://opendtect.org/OpendTect_license.txt
8  Author: Y.C. Liu
9  Date: 03-28-2007
10  RCS: $Id$
11 _________________________________________________________________________
12 
13 -*/
14 
15 #include "uidialog.h"
16 
17 class IOObjContext;
18 class uiIOObjSel;
19 class CtxtIOObj;
20 
21 namespace VolProc
22 {
23 
24 class VolumeReader;
25 class ProcessingStep;
26 
27 mClass(VolProcTest) uiReader : public uiDialog
28 {
29 
30 public:
31  static void initClass();
32 
35 protected:
36  static uiDialog* create(uiParent*,ProcessingStep*);
38 
40 
43 };
44 
45 
46 };
VolProc::uiReader::volreader_
VolumeReader * volreader_
Definition: uivolumereader.h:39
VolProc
Adapter for a VolProc chain to external attribute calculation.
Definition: seisdatapackwriter.h:24
VolProc::uiReader::initClass
static void initClass()
CtxtIOObj
Holds an IOObjCtxt plus a pointer to an IOObj and/or an IOPar.
Definition: ctxtioobj.h:146
VolProc::uiReader
Definition: uivolumereader.h:28
VolProc::VolumeReader
Reads in a volume. Will replace previous values if data is present in the read volume.
Definition: volprocvolreader.h:32
CallBacker
Inherit from this class to be able to send and/or receive CallBacks.
Definition: callback.h:185
VolProc::uiReader::uiReader
uiReader(uiParent *, VolumeReader *)
mClass
#define mClass(module)
Definition: commondefs.h:181
IOObjContext
Holds the context for selecting and/or creating IOObjs.
Definition: ctxtioobj.h:62
uidialog.h
VolProc::uiReader::acceptOK
bool acceptOK(CallBacker *)
confirm accept
VolProc::uiReader::iocontext_
CtxtIOObj * iocontext_
Definition: uivolumereader.h:42
VolProc::uiReader::~uiReader
~uiReader()
uiIOObjSel
User Interface (UI) element for selection of IOObjs.
Definition: uiioobjsel.h:38
VolProc::uiReader::uinputselfld_
uiIOObjSel * uinputselfld_
Definition: uivolumereader.h:41
uiParent
Definition: uiparent.h:26
uiDialog
Definition: uidialog.h:42
VolProc::uiReader::create
static uiDialog * create(uiParent *, ProcessingStep *)

Generated at for the OpendTect seismic interpretation project. Copyright (C): dGB Beheer B.V. 1995-2021